Why Minor Crashes Produce Major Medical Bills
Vehicle damage and human injury don’t scale together. A fender-bender at 15 mph can produce a whiplash injury that requires months of physical therapy. A low-speed rear-end collision can herniate a cervical disc. The car looks fine. You feel fine at the scene. Two days later, you can barely turn your head.
This disconnect — between visible vehicle damage and real physical injury — is exactly what insurance adjusters exploit. They photograph the minor damage and use it as their primary argument that your injuries couldn’t have been serious. The medical literature tells a different story: soft tissue injuries from low-speed impacts are real, documented, and frequently undercompensated.

What Counts as a Fender Bender?
A fender bender is typically a low-speed collision that causes minimal visible damage. These accidents often occur at intersections, in parking lots, during lane merges, or in heavy traffic.
The term “fender bender” might sound minor, but Nevada law still treats it as a motor vehicle accident, which means you have legal obligations and the right to pursue compensation.

Nevada Law and Your Responsibilities
Under Nevada Revised Statute (NRS) 484E.030, anyone involved in an accident, no matter how small, must stop, exchange information, and report the crash when required. Skipping this step could lead to fines or even criminal charges.
If your fender bender is also a hit-and-run, it becomes more complex. We help victims file uninsured motorist claims or work with investigators to locate the driver.
Who Can Be Liable in a Fender Bender?
Determining fault is about more than pointing to the other driver. Liability in a fender bender can rest with several parties.
The other driver is often responsible for rear-end collisions or failure-to-yield accidents. Sometimes, more than one driver shares fault under Nevada’s comparative negligence rule. A vehicle owner could be liable if they allowed an unfit driver to use their car. Employers can be held responsible if an employee on the job caused the crash. In cases involving defective brakes or unsafe road conditions, manufacturers or government entities may also share liability.

What Insurers Do With Unrepresented Minor Accident Claims
Insurance companies track whether or not you have legal representation. When you don’t, the playbook is predictable: call quickly, offer a modest settlement before your full injury picture develops, and get you to sign a release before you know what you’re signing away.
A signed release ends your claim permanently. Once you’ve accepted a settlement and signed the release, you cannot reopen the claim if your symptoms worsen. That $2,000 check for what turned out to be a herniated disc closes the door on recovering the full value of your injury.

Steps to Take After a Fender Bender in Las Vegas
Right after a fender bender, protect your health and your legal case by following these steps:
Check for injuries and call 911 if needed. Move to safety to avoid secondary crashes. Exchange contact, insurance, and driver’s license information with all involved parties. Take photos of the scene, damage, and any visible injuries. Gather witness details if possible. See a doctor promptly even if you feel okay, as some injuries take time to surface.
